全面解析USDT虚拟货币钱包开发指南

          发布时间:2024-09-14 03:34:44
          ### 虚拟货币钱包开发USDT的详细介绍 在过去的十年里,虚拟货币的崛起引起了全球范围内的广泛关注与应用,特别是比特币和以太坊等知名数字资产。同时,作为一种稳定币,USDT(Tether)凭借其与美元1:1锚定的特性,成为了市场上最被广泛使用的数字货币之一。在USDT逐渐获得认可的背景下,开发一款安全、稳定且高效的USDT钱包,显得尤为重要。 #### 1. USDT钱包的意义 虚拟货币钱包的本质是一个数字化工具,用户可以用来存储、接收和发送虚拟货币。USDT钱包作为承载USDT的工具,使得用户能够轻松进行交易、转账和投资等等。同时,USDT钱包还能为用户提供一个安全的环境,保护他们的资产。
          • 便捷性:用户可以通过钱包快速完成交易,而无需频繁操作。

          • 安全性:优秀的钱包会提供多重安全措施,包括冷钱包存储、双重认证等。

          • 隐私保护:用户的交易信息可以得到充分的隐私保护。

          #### 2. 开发USDT钱包的技术选型 开发一个功能齐全的USDT钱包,需要从多个技术层面进行考虑,主要包括以下几个方面。 ##### 2.1 选择区块链平台 目前,USDT主要基于以太坊和Tron网络,因此在开发时需要选择合适的区块链平台。例如,如果选择以太坊,可以使用ERC20标准;如果选用Tron,则需要遵循TRC20标准。 ##### 2.2 用语言和框架 开发语言的选择往往会影响到项目的整体性能,常见的语言包括Node.js、Java、Python等。而在前端,可以使用React、Angular等流行框架来提升用户体验。 ##### 2.3 数据库选择 无论是SQL还是NoSQL数据库,二者各有优势,具体选择应根据项目需求来决定。 #### 3. USDT钱包的功能设计 功能设计是钱包开发过程中不可或缺的一部分,用户体验的优劣直接影响到钱包的使用频率。以下是一些必备的功能模块。 ##### 3.1 创建和导入钱包 用户需要能够方便地创建新钱包,或者导入已有的钱包。相关的私钥和助记词应当妥善保管,以免重要信息丢失。 ##### 3.2 收发功能 钱包需要支持USDT的收发功能,用户应能通过简单的操作完成交易。 ##### 3.3 历史记录 提供清晰的交易历史记录,方便用户进行查询和管理。 ##### 3.4 安全性设置 集成安全功能,如生物识别登录、双重认证等,以增强用户财产的安全性。 ##### 3.5 客服支持 提供客户支持功能,帮助用户解决在使用中遇到的问题。 ### 相关问题 ####

          如何保证USDT钱包的安全性?

          在当前数字货币盛行的背景下,安全性成了用户最为关心的问题之一。对于开发者来说,保证钱包的安全性需要从多个方面入手。

          • 私钥管理:私钥是控制用户资金的关键,开发者应采取冷存储等方法,将私钥与互联网隔离,防止黑客攻击。

          • 双重认证:为用户提供额外的安全验证,确保只有用户本人可以访问钱包。

          • 加密技术:采用现代加密技术,对用户的数据进行加密存储,防止信息泄露。

          • 代码审计:定期进行代码审计和漏洞检测,确保没有安全隐患。

          ####

          如何提升USDT钱包的用户体验?

          用户体验是软件开发一个不可忽视的重要方面,良好的用户体验可以提升用户的黏性和活跃度。

          • 界面友好:将复杂的操作通过简洁的界面呈现,使用户更易于上手。

          • 响应速度:系统性能,确保交易速度满足用户的需求,减少等待时间。

          • 教程与支持:提供详细的使用教程和客户支持,帮助用户解决使用中遇到的问题。

          • 定期反馈:通过用户反馈不断系统功能,提升用户满意度。

          ####

          USDT钱包开发的成本如何估算?

          开发USDT钱包的成本包括多个方面,综合评估后才能得出准确的估算。

          • 研发人员薪资:根据团队规模、经验等因素,研发人员的薪资是主要成本之一。

          • 技术服务费:若考虑外包或顾问服务,相关费用需要纳入总成本中。

          • 后期维护:钱包上线后,还需进行安全和性能的持续维护,需要一定的预算。

          • 市场推广:若打算推向市场,市场推广的费用也是需要考虑的一部分。

          ####

          选择开发USDT钱包的团队需考虑哪些因素?

          团队的选择对项目成功与否至关重要,以下是一些需考虑的重要因素。

          • 专业技能:团队成员的技术能力,尤其是在区块链和加密领域的经验。

          • 项目经验:团队过往的项目经验和成功案例遍数,能体现其专业性和可靠性。

          • 沟通能力:团队与客户之间的沟通能力,确保项目需求得到准确理解和实现。

          • 售后支持:良好的售后支持能在项目上线后,及时解决用户问题。

          ####

          USDT钱包的市场前景如何?

          随着虚拟货币的普及,USDT作为稳定币的地位愈发重要,因此钱包的市场前景广阔。

          • 用户基础:USDT的用户基数庞大,使得需求量剧增。

          • 多元化需求:用户对钱包的需求日益多元,除了简单的存储和转账功能外,还希望引入更多的金融服务。

          • 合规政策:随着监管政策的逐步明确,合规的钱包获取用户信任的机会更多。

          • 技术革新:不断更新和革命性的技术推动着市场不断向前发展,钱包开发也将面临新的挑战与机遇。

          ### 总结 开发一款高效、稳定、安全的USDT虚拟货币钱包,既是市场的需求,也是一个颇具挑战性的任务。在技术选型、功能设计、安全性提升等多方面,各个开发者都需充分考虑,为用户提供良好的使用体验,从而在竞争日益激烈的市场中稳固地位。
          分享 :
              author

              tpwallet

              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                              相关新闻

                              比特币钱包客户端的容量
                              2024-10-04
                              比特币钱包客户端的容量

                              在数字货币的时代,比特币作为最早也是最著名的一种加密货币,受到了广泛的关注。为了安全地存储和管理比特币...

                              比特币钱包推荐:速度快
                              2024-11-05
                              比特币钱包推荐:速度快

                              在当今的数字货币世界里,比特币的流行使得选择合适的钱包变得尤为重要。特别是对于那些频繁进行交易的用户来...

                              如何兑换比特币钱包?
                              2024-04-16
                              如何兑换比特币钱包?

                              什么是比特币钱包? 比特币钱包是一种用于存储、发送和接收比特币的数字钱包。它可以存储私钥,这是访问拥有的...

                              如何下载USDT钱包并解决无
                              2024-07-30
                              如何下载USDT钱包并解决无

                              内容大纲:1. 介绍USDT钱包2. 下载USDT钱包的步骤3. 无法下载USDT钱包的可能原因4. 解决无法下载USDT钱包的方法5. 常见问...